In a short circuit condition, the voltage across the circuit element or the entire circuit essentially reduces to zero. This occurs because a short circuit provides a path of very low resistance for current to flow, effectively bypassing any significant voltage drop across the components in the circuit.

The concept of a short circuit is important in understanding how electrical systems behave under fault conditions. In reality, when a short circuit occurs, the current can rise dramatically due to this very low resistance path, but the voltage measured at the terminals of the short-circuited element is effectively zero.
